"Accounting Management Simplified" provides a clear and concise explanation of accounting management and management accounting, focusing on how managers make decisions. We explore the relationship between management accounting and other business fields, helping students understand its role within management education. Our book covers the generation of management accounting information, cost classifications, and cost systems used by managers to assess the impact of decisions on an organization's profits or goals. We delve into practice and application, comparing financial and management accounting, and discussing traditional versus innovative practices. The book examines the role of management accounting within a corporation, specific methodologies like Activity-Based Costing (ABC), and rate and volume analysis. We also cover managerial risk, profit models, and various types of accounting. Tools of account management are explained, with each topic including sub-headings, brief explanations, and references for further learning. A complete and balanced reference, Public Budgeting Systems, Eighth Edition surveys the current state of budgeting throughout all levels of the United States government. The text emphasizes methods by which financial decisions are reached within a system as well as ways in which different types of information are used in budgetary decision-making. It also stresses the use of program information, since, for decades, budget reforms have sought to introduce greater program considerations into financial decisions.
